Platyperla mendosa Sinitshenkova 1995 (stonefly)

Insecta - Plecoptera - Platyperlidae

Full reference: N. D. Sinitshenkova. 1995. New late Mesozoic stoneflies from Shara-Teeg, Mongolia (Insecta: Perlida-Plecoptera). Paleontological Journal 29(4):93-104

Belongs to Platyperla according to N. D. Sinitshenkova 1995

Sister taxa: Platyperla admissa, Platyperla caudiculata, Platyperla conferta, Platyperla kingi, Platyperla marquati, Platyperla parricidalis, Platyperla platypoda, Platyperla propera, Platyperla rigida

Type specimen: PIN 4270/281, a nymph. Its type locality is Shar-Teg, outcrop 443/1 (PIN collection 4270), which is in a Tithonian lacustrine - large mudstone in the Sharteg Formation of Mongolia.

Ecology: volant detritivore-omnivore

Distribution: found only at Shar-Teg, outcrop 443/1 (PIN collection 4270)
